What is an Automotive Technical Support Specialist?
An automotive technical support specialist is a professional who specializes in providing technical support to customers in the automotive industry. They are trained to diagnose and troubleshoot problems with cars, and to provide guidance on how to fix them. They work for car manufacturers, dealerships, and other automotive companies, and are typically responsible for providing support over the phone or online.

How to Become an Automotive Technical Support Specialist
If you're interested in becoming an automotive technical support specialist, there are a few key skills and qualifications you'll need. First and foremost, you'll need a strong knowledge of cars and the automotive industry. This can come from formal education, such as a degree in automotive technology or engineering, or from years of experience working with cars.
You'll also need excellent communication skills, both oral and written. As an automotive technical support specialist, you'll be working with customers over the phone and online, so it's important to be able to communicate clearly and effectively. And you'll need to be patient and empathetic, as many customers may be frustrated or upset when they contact you for help.
Question and Answer
Q: What kind of training do automotive technical support specialists receive?
A: Automotive technical support specialists typically receive extensive training in the automotive industry, including formal education in automotive technology or engineering, as well as on-the-job training and ongoing professional development.
Q: How can I find an automotive technical support specialist?
A: Many car manufacturers and dealerships offer technical support to their customers. You can typically find contact information for technical support specialists on the company's website, or by calling their customer service line.
Q: What kind of problems can automotive technical support specialists help me with?
A: Automotive technical support specialists can help you diagnose and troubleshoot a wide range of problems with your car, from simple maintenance tasks like changing your oil or replacing your brakes, to more complex issues like diagnosing engine problems or fixing electrical issues.
Q: How much does it cost to work with an automotive technical support specialist?
A: Many car manufacturers and dealerships offer technical support to their customers for free as part of their customer service offerings. However, some companies may charge a fee for technical support services, so it's important to check with the company before seeking help.
